High Mobility Stemless InSb Nanowires
Nano Letters, 2019High aspect-ratio InSb nanowires (NWs) of high chemical purity are sought for implementing advanced quantum devices. The growth of InSb NWs is challenging, generally requiring a stem of a foreign material for nucleation. Such a stem tends to limit the length of InSb NWs and its material becomes incorporated in the InSb segment.

On the Extraction of Charge Carrier Mobility in High‐Mobility Organic Transistors
Advanced Materials, 2015Transistor parameter extraction by the conventional transconductance method can lead to a mobility overestimate. Organic transistors undergoing major contact resistance experience a significant drop in mobility upon mild annealing. Before annealing, strong field-dependent contact resistance yields nonlinear transfer curves with locally high ...

High-Mobility Semiconducting Naphthodithiophene Copolymers
Journal of the American Chemical Society, 2010We have designed and synthesized novel semiconducting polymers by introducing naphtho[1,2-b:5,6-b']dithiophene (NDT) into the polythiophene backbone. These polymers, which have a highly pi-extended heteroarene unit, achieved mobilities (>0.5 cm(2) V(-1) s(-1)) that are among the highest recorded to date for semiconducting polymers and most probably ...

Mobile RFID with a High Identification Rate
IEEE Transactions on Computers, 2014An important category of mobile RFID systems is the RFID system with mobile RFID tags. The mobility of RFID tags poses new challenges to designing RFID anti-collision protocols. Existing RFID anti-collision protocols cannot support high tag moving speed and high identification rate simultaneously.
